datasavior.com was compromised in a ransomware attack attributed to m3rx in May 2026. The organization, operating in the Technology sector in United States, was added to the group's data leak site as part of an extortion campaign.

m3rx operates as a financially motivated ransomware-as-a-service (RaaS) operation, exfiltrating sensitive data and threatening public disclosure to pressure victims into paying ransom demands.
